Understanding the Core Concepts of Shemle Star DB
To fully grasp the capabilities of Shemle Star DB, you need to familiarize yourself with its core principles. Below are the foundational elements that make this database stand out:
1. Hybrid Storage Model
Shemle Star DB uses a hybrid storage engine that combines row-based and columnar storage models. This dual approach enables faster read and write speeds while ensuring efficient storage consumption.
2. Distributed Architecture
Built to scale, Shemle Star DB is distributed across multiple nodes, making it capable of handling large datasets and high traffic without delays. This architecture ensures horizontal scaling, which is perfect for growing organizations.
3. SQL and NoSQL Support
Shemle Star DB provides a unique flexibility by supporting both SQL (for structured data) and NoSQL (for semi-structured or unstructured data). This allows developers to work within a unified environment regardless of the data format.
4. Real-Time Processing
The database supports real-time analytics, making it an ideal choice for use cases where immediate data insights are critical.
